Cherry is the kind of flavour that sounds ordinary until you try a genuinely good version of it. Cuba White Cherry is one of those versions. It opens with a bold, sweet-sharp note that is unmistakably red cherry rather than the synthetic black-cherry approximation a lot of products settle for. Within the first minute it finds a balance: not excessively sweet, not harshly tart, just a clean, vivid cherry flavour that holds its own across a thirty-minute session without tipping into candy territory.

It is also worth saying that Cuba Cherry is not some niche pick: according to independent guides that track nicotine pouch popularity across the whole market, it sits at number one for the cherry flavour category and in the top fifteen globally across all flavours. More than 1,600 reviews have been logged at one specialist retailer alone. That level of consensus from pouch users tends to correlate with a flavour that is genuinely well-balanced rather than just aggressively marketed. Made by Nicotobacco Factory in Poland, sold here in packs of ten tins at £34.99, that is £3.50 a tin and about 17p per pouch.
The dominant note is sweet, bright cherry with a slight sharpness that stops it from being cloying. Think Morello rather than glace: there is a real fruit quality to it, not just sweetness with cherry flavouring added on top. The tartness is there from the start, which gives the flavour immediate presence, and it carries through the session rather than disappearing after the first few minutes.
The evolution over a thirty-minute use is notable. The initial bright edge settles into something a little warmer and more rounded mid-session, with the cherry character becoming richer rather than sharper. By the end of the pouch the flavour is quieter but still recognisable. That steady development, rather than a sharp peak and a fast fade, is one of the reasons this flavour gets so many return buyers.
Among the Cuba White range, Cherry is the most intensely flavoured of the single-fruit options in the sweet-sharp direction. Cuba White Black Currant is more tangy and complex; Cuba White Blackberry is darker and more progressive in its sweetness. Cherry sits squarely in the bright, immediate camp: you know exactly what you are getting within ten seconds, and that clarity is part of the appeal.
Each pouch contains 10.4mg of nicotine. The label reads "16mg" which is the concentration per gram of material rather than the per-pouch figure; since each slim pouch weighs 0.65 grams, 16 times 0.65 gives 10.4mg. It is a detail that matters when comparing between brands because the industry has not standardised on one way to express strength.
For context: Cuba White is the entry tier of the Cuba brand, but that does not mean it is an entry-level product in the broader nicotine pouch market. Ten-point-four milligrams puts it comfortably above mainstream brands' mid-range offerings. Most people who have been smoking around ten cigarettes a day find it sits well. The nicotine release is gradual by design: pouches are not meant to spike the way a cigarette does, so the experience feels steadier and more sustained rather than sharp.
If you find the White level comfortable after a while and want more, Cuba makes Cherry in a Black version (Cuba Black Cherry) at a considerably higher strength, same flavour profile, same format. That is the logical step up if the White starts to feel too light. In the other direction, if you are new to pouches, 10.4mg is on the higher end of what you should start with; many pouch brands offer lighter options in the 4-6mg range for complete beginners.

| Nicotine per pouch | 10.4mg |
|---|---|
| Nicotine per gram | 16mg/g |
| Pouches per tin | 20 |
| Tins per pack (VapeCity) | 10 |
| Pouch weight | ~0.65g per pouch |
| Net weight per tin | 13g |
| Pouch format | Slim, all-white |
| Tobacco content | None (tobacco-free) |
| Flavour | Cherry (bold, sweet-tangy) |
| Manufacturer | Nicotobacco Factory, Poland |
| Usage duration | 30-40 minutes per pouch |
| UK legal | Yes, 18+ only |
